About Jerram L. Brown
Jerram L. Brown is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Ecology, Nature and Landscape Conservation, Applied Mathematics and Genetics, having authored 147 papers that have together received 7.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ant and animal studies (38 papers), Animal Behavior and Reproduction (30 papers), Avian ecology and behavior (27 papers),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(13 papers),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(12 papers), Mathematical Analysis and Transform Methods (12 papers), Animal Ecology and Behavior Studies (11 papers) and Image and Signal Denoising Methods (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Developmental Biology (583 citations),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(4.5k citations), Ecology (3.7k citations), Nature and Landscape Conservation (1.0k citations) and Ecological Modeling (273 citations). Jerram L. Brown has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and Russia. Frequent co-authors include Gordon H. Orians, Esther R. Brown, Amy Eklund, Shou‐Hsien Li, Kathleen Egid, Nirmal Bhagabati, Sheryl D. Brown, Douglas Dow, David L. Hull and Marcy F. Lawton. Their work appears in journals such as Ornithological Applications, Animal Behaviour, Science, Nature and The Auk.
